Delta City is OCP's master plan for the ruinous expanse of crime-infested sprawl that is Old Detroit. The Old Man's dream is for an efficient, clean and harmonious city, maintained and serviced by OCP and subdivisions, an unending project with unending rewards, policed by ED-209s, RoboCops and the OCP-funded Detroit Police Department.

Eventually the labor leaders agreed to sanction construction of Delta City, a project that would create about a million of new jobs. People was worrying worker safety. Vice President Bob Morton assured that Security Concepts estimated that crime would be annihilated in a month, thanks to RoboCop.

Behind the Scenes

An early indication of the viability and sincerity of this project is revealed when lovably innocent Junior Executive Mr. Kinney is blasted onto a model of Delta City and machine-gunned to death by a malfunctioning ED-209. The script goes into detail about how Kinney's blood flows in miniature rivers through the model's streets and between squashed skyscrapers.
